Diversity
Tagged Divisions
Pre-College Engineering Education Division
diverse group of NASAspecialists and saw work-in-progress happening on NASA missions. Students were able toobserve NASA scientists, engineers, and mathematicians in action, and participate in discussionswith mission specialists. The intent of the NASA visit was to expand the students’ views ofSTEM fields and to expose the students to what a STEM career entails.3 Survey InstrumentsStudents participating in the outreach activity completed pre- and post-surveys during theactivity. After analyzing the surveys for the initial year of the program, the surveys were retooledin the 2012/13 academic year to capture more data. defined as “the extent towhich one intends to engage in an activity”4. The choice or the decision to continue doing an activity,for example, is the result of someone’s motivation of doing that activity. Motivation has been exploredin relation to academic performance and career plans. Jones et al. studied the relationship amongexpectancies, values, achievement, and career plans for first year engineering students. They found thatstudents’ expectancy and value related beliefs decreased over the first year3 thus negatively influencingstudents’ retention into the second year of an engineering program.
